Monetizing Your Solitaire Game
Monetization strategies are critical in turning your Solitaire game into a profitable venture. Here are some techniques to consider:
1. Freemium Model
Offer the game for free with optional in-app purchases for additional features, customized themes, or hints. This model has proven successful in the mobile gaming market.
2. Advertisement Integration
Utilize ad networks to display ads within the game. Ensure that ads are non-intrusive, allowing users to have an uninterrupted gaming experience.
3. Subscription Services
Consider implementing a subscription model that offers premium features for a monthly fee, such as exclusive game modes or ad-free experiences.
